Does anyone know what the ignition timing should be set at on the 2.9 V6 12valve 1996

Just came acros this one from way back, which no one seems to have responded to.
 
There is no ignition timing to adjust, it is all under the automatic control of the engine management system which advances and retards the ignition under the control of a computer system known as the EEC-IV.  
 
There is one sensor which provides the above with a pulse at top dead centre (I believe) as a reference point and the actual firing point is then decided by the EEC-IV based upon its inputs from its other sensors.

Not strictly true, if you mess with the distrubter at all you have to reset the timming in service mode to 15 degree BTDC then when the ECU takes over it runs at about 30 BTDC but then varies depending on sensor readings.
 
There is no sensor that detects TDC only the distrubter which you need to adjust but only if you mess with it.
